There is no solvent that will move it without doing damage to everthing around it. You might try heat. A little shot with a heat gun makes guide wrap removal much easier. If you must remove the seat, lets hope you have at least an eighth inch of seat bushing. Take a dremel with a carbide wheel, make four lengthwise cuts around the seat This is where the eight inch bushing allows you to cut seat and not blank. Apply some heat and pry the four sections from the blank. Go slow and careful with the dremel and heat.
